Partilhar via


MapsAccountSasContent Classe

Definição

Parâmetros usados para criar um token SAS (Assinatura de Acesso Compartilhado) da conta. O controle de acesso da API REST é fornecido por Azure Mapas identidade e acesso rbac (acesso baseado em função).

public class MapsAccountSasContent
type MapsAccountSasContent = class
Public Class MapsAccountSasContent
Herança
MapsAccountSasContent

Construtores

MapsAccountSasContent(MapsSigningKey, String, Int32, String, String)

Inicializa uma nova instância de MapasAccountSasContent.

Propriedades

Expiry

O deslocamento de data e hora de quando a validade do token expira. Por exemplo, "2017-05-24T10:42:03.1567373Z".

MaxRatePerSecond

Parâmetro obrigatório que representa a solicitação máxima desejada por segundo a ser permitida para o token SAS fornecido. Isso não garante a precisão perfeita nas medidas, mas fornece proteções seguras de aplicativos de abuso com eventual imposição.

PrincipalId

A ID da entidade de segurança também conhecida como a ID de objeto de uma Identidade Gerenciada Atribuída pelo Usuário atualmente atribuída à Conta de Mapa. Para atribuir uma Identidade Gerenciada da conta, use a operação Criar ou Atualizar uma ID de recurso atribuir uma identidade atribuída pelo usuário.

Regions

Opcional, permite o controle de quais locais de região têm permissão para acessar Azure Mapas APIs REST com o token SAS. Exemplo: "eastus", "westus2". Omitir esse parâmetro permitirá que todos os locais da região sejam acessíveis.

SigningKey

A chave da conta do Mapa a ser usada para assinatura.

Start

O deslocamento de data e hora de quando a validade do token é iniciada. Por exemplo, "2017-05-24T10:42:03.1567373Z".

Aplica-se a